Understanding the Importance of an Asylum Support Letter

An asylum support letter is a detailed document that outlines your reasons for seeking asylum, providing personal, social, and economic context that supports your case. It is essential to understand that a free letter to immigration sample for asylum case should not be a generic template but rather a personalized account of your experiences and the reasons you fear persecution in your home country.

Key Elements of an Asylum Support Letter

A well-structured asylum support letter should include the following elements:

  • Introduction: A brief overview of your situation and the purpose of the letter.
  • Personal Background: Information about your identity, nationality, and any relevant personal history.
  • Reasons for Seeking Asylum: A detailed account of the persecution or harm you fear, including specific incidents and dates.
  • Supporting Evidence: Any documentation or evidence that supports your claim, such as police reports, medical records, or witness statements.
  • Conclusion: A summary of your situation and a clear request for asylum.

How to Write an Effective Asylum Support Letter

Writing an effective asylum support letter requires careful consideration of your situation and the specific requirements of your case. Here are some tips to keep in mind:

  • Be clear and concise: Use simple language to explain complex situations.
  • Be specific: Include dates, times, and details of incidents.
  • Be honest: Provide a truthful account of your experiences.
  • Use supporting evidence: Include documentation that supports your claim.
